Output 895a632c6f8b42039a184558c8a6b81f79dde4d5df2e038df390bba77454317a:1

value
433878
script pubkey
OP_0 OP_PUSHBYTES_20 7ca23055b92b5b366b713c93ffc1ac8adc043e1a
address
ltc1q0j3rq4de9ddnv6m38jfllsdv3twqg0s6nrrvtx
transaction
895a632c6f8b42039a184558c8a6b81f79dde4d5df2e038df390bba77454317a
spent
true